Giesen () is a village and a municipality in the district of Hildesheim, in Lower Saxony, Germany. It is situated approximately 6 km northwest of Hildesheim, and 22 km southeast of Hanover.
The municipality includes five villages: Ahrbergen (pop. 2,219) Emmerke (pop. 1,684) Giesen (pop. 3,401) Groß Förste (pop. 795) Hasede (pop. 1,606)
